In today's dynamic business environment, the role of strategic management has become increasingly crucial for organizations to stay competitive and achieve long-term success. Pursuing a Master of Science in Strategic Management (MSc Strategic Management) offers students the opportunity to delve deep into the intricacies of formulating and implementing effective strategies that drive organizational growth and sustainability.

Key Benefits of MSc Strategic Management

Here are some key benefits of pursuing an MSc in Strategic Management:

Benefit Description
Enhanced Strategic Thinking Develop critical thinking skills to analyze complex business scenarios and make informed strategic decisions.
Global Perspective Gain insights into international business practices and learn to develop strategies for global markets.
Leadership Development Enhance leadership skills to effectively lead teams and drive organizational change.
Networking Opportunities Build a strong professional network with industry experts, faculty members, and fellow students.

Job Opportunities

Graduates of MSc Strategic Management programs are well-equipped to pursue various career opportunities in the field of strategic management. Some common job roles include:

  • Strategic Planning Manager
  • Business Development Manager
  • Management Consultant
  • Corporate Strategist
